Build the Operational Backbone That Powers Maternal Health EquityMEET MAEMae is a venture-backed digital health solution on a mission to improve the health and quality of life for mothers, babies, and those who love them. Mae has created a space where complete digital care meets culturally-competent on-the-ground support. We address access gaps and bolster physical and emotional well-being through continuous engagement, risk assessment, early symptom awareness, and a community-led model of support for our users.Digital solutions to address cultural deficits in care are at the forefront of femtech innovation, and Mae is quickly gaining traction with healthcare payers as a viable solution to address the implicit, explicit, and structural biases that hinder equitable maternal health. In addressing whole-person care and focusing on self-advocacy, education, and community, we seek to improve outcomes for mothers and birthing people, while also reducing clinical costs of care at scale.At Mae, we are solution-oriented, accountable, data-driven, adaptable, and mission-connected. We take ownership seriously.We are looking for a Director of Operations who thrives at the intersection of enterprise systems, financial performance, and cross-functional execution.This is not a maintenance operations role. You will architect and strengthen Mae’s operational infrastructure to support scalable growth, revenue integrity, and disciplined execution across the organization.If you are energized by building structure in complex environments and comfortable owning both operational clarity and financial performance, including managing the claims and billing team, we would love to meet you.What You’ll OwnEnterprise Operations StrategyAssess operational workflows across Product, Member Experience, Client Success, Compliance, and GrowthDesign and implement standardized process frameworksEstablish documentation governance standardsReduce cross-functional friction through structured process designEnsure operational systems scale with company growthProduct & Operations IntegrationParticipate in discovery and planning conversations for major product initiativesDocument current-state workflows to support accurate feature developmentProvide operational clarity during feature designStrengthen feedback loops between functional teams and ProductSupport operational readiness for launchesFinancial Alignment & Cross-Functional OptimizationIdentify process gaps impacting revenue, margin, or operational performanceEvaluate handoffs that create delays or financial leakagePartner with the COO and Chief Growth Officer to align operational improvements with financial goalsUse data and operational modeling to prioritize high-impact improvementsDrive adoption of new processes without direct reporting authorityRevenue Cycle LeadershipDirect management of the Claims & Billing teamMonitor denial trends, underpayments, and revenue leakage risksPartner with Compliance on billing investigations and FWA preventionEnsure billing operations support revenue integrity and compliance standardsChange Management & Tool OwnershipLead operational change initiatives related to vendor or system transitionsRedesign workflows impacted by tool updatesMeasure post-implementation effectivenessEvaluate and recommend systems as operational needs evolveWhat Makes Someone Successful at MaeYou are:Comfortable owning outcomesFinancially disciplined and data-drivenStrong in cross-functional influence without direct authorityStructured in your thinking and clear in communicationAble to build systems in fast-moving environmentsMission-connected but business-mindedYou understand that operational excellence enables health equity. Strong systems drive sustainable impact.Experience We’re Looking For5+ years in healthcare operations, enterprise process improvement, or revenue cycle leadership2+ years of people management experienceDemonstrated success designing and improving cross-functional systemsStrong analytical capability, including advanced Excel proficiencyExperience connecting operational decisions to financial performanceExperience influencing senior stakeholders without direct authorityPreferred:MBA or equivalent operational trainingExposure to P&L ownershipLean, Six Sigma, or similar process improvement methodologyStartup or growth-stage company experienceExperience operationalizing new product featuresWhat We OfferSalary range: $120,000 – $140,000 annually, depending on experienceEquity participationHealthcare, dental, vision benefitsFlexible remote work environmentMae Health Participates in E-VerifyThis employer participates in E-Verify and will provide the federal government with your Form I-9 information to confirm that you are authorized to work in the U.S. If E-Verify cannot confirm that you are authorized to work, this employer is required to give you written instructions and an opportunity to contact DHS or SSA so you can begin to resolve the issue before any employment action is taken.
